Can I run Step-3.5-Flash-REAP-121B-A11B on a GeForce RTX 5070?
Not at these settings. No indexed quantization of Step-3.5-Flash-REAP-121B-A11B fits GeForce RTX 5070 at any context we compute, with q8_0 KV. The smallest shipped quantization is 22.74 GiB in weights alone, against 11.16 GiB usable. CPU offload can still run it, slowly.

Figures are GiB of total memory: weights plus KV cache plus compute buffer and backend overhead. Weights and KV are near-exact; the overhead term is modeled. Hover any cell for the breakdown.
Why other calculators disagree
A parameters × bits ÷ 8 estimate ignores two things that dominate at long context. First, the weights themselves are not the nominal rate — quantizations are mixtures, so the real file is consistently larger than the label implies. Second, most of this model's layers cache only a 512-token window rather than the full context.
